The Ultrasonic Transducer Cab Market was valued at USD 365.47 million in 2025 and is projected to grow to USD 388.02 million in 2026, with a CAGR of 5.89%, reaching USD 545.75 million by 2032.

KEY MARKET STATISTICS
Base Year [2025] USD 365.47 million
Estimated Year [2026] USD 388.02 million
Forecast Year [2032] USD 545.75 million
CAGR (%) 5.89%

A strategic overview of the ultrasonic transducer cab ecosystem highlighting technological enablers, supply complexities, and stakeholder imperatives for sustained competitiveness

The ultrasonic transducer cab sector sits at the intersection of materials science, precision electronics, and systems integration, and it supports a wide array of downstream applications from industrial inspection to medical imaging and underwater sensing. Technological advances in piezoelectric materials, microfabrication, and electronics miniaturization have driven improvements in sensitivity, bandwidth, and reliability over the past decade. Meanwhile, manufacturing practices have migrated toward tighter integration between transducer modules and signal processing electronics to reduce latency and improve system-level performance.

Stakeholders face an increasingly complex operating environment characterized by supply chain fragility, intensified intellectual property competition, and evolving regulatory expectations for medical and defense applications. Procurement teams must balance cost pressures with the need for validated performance and long-term supplier reliability. Engineers, for their part, must evaluate emergent transducer types and frequency ranges against application-specific performance criteria, while commercial leaders prioritize channels that provide responsiveness and scalability.

Taken together, these dynamics create both challenges and opportunities for organizations that can align R&D, sourcing, and commercial execution. Strategic attention to material selection, supplier qualification, and modular system architectures will determine who captures value as markets evolve. The following sections examine the shifts reshaping the landscape, the implications of tariff-driven trade policy changes, segmentation-specific insights, regional dynamics, competitive positioning, and the tactical steps industry leaders should take to sustain growth and resilience.

How converging technological advances, supply chain realignment, and regulatory evolution are redefining strategic priorities and innovation pathways in the sector

The landscape for ultrasonic transducer cab technologies is undergoing transformative shifts driven by both technological progression and systemic changes in global supply networks. On the technology front, incremental improvements in piezoelectric materials and the maturation of micromachined approaches are enabling narrower tolerances and broader bandwidths, which in turn expand the range of feasible applications. Concurrently, advances in embedded signal processing and machine learning are allowing system designers to extract higher-value information from the same transducer hardware, raising performance expectations across industries.

Market dynamics are shifting toward modular, interoperable architectures that reduce time-to-market and enable rapid customization for specific use cases. This architectural pivot interacts with procurement strategies, encouraging longer-term partnerships and co-development programs with suppliers who can demonstrate design-for-manufacturability and robust quality systems. Another notable shift is the acceleration of nearshoring and regional supply diversification, which stems from heightened geopolitical tension and a renewed focus on supply chain continuity. Companies increasingly weigh the cost of proximity against the strategic benefits of shorter, more controllable supply chains.

Finally, regulatory and standards activity continues to influence design cycles, especially in medical and defense applications where qualification timelines can shape competitive advantage. Together these forces are reorienting investment priorities toward flexible manufacturing, stronger IP portfolios, and closer collaboration between transducer designers, system integrators, and end users to meet evolving performance and compliance expectations.

The cumulative operational and strategic consequences of recent United States tariff measures through 2025 on sourcing, pricing, and supply chain resilience for transducer producers

Trade policy developments, and specifically tariff actions emanating from the United States through 2025, have exerted a material influence on sourcing strategies, component pricing, and supplier relationships across the ultrasonic transducer cab supply chain. Tariff pressures have heightened the total landed cost of key components and subassemblies for many buyers, prompting buying organizations to reassess supplier footprints, qualification timelines, and inventory policies. As a result, procurement teams have increased scrutiny of cost-to-serve metrics and accelerated supplier diversification efforts to mitigate exposure to single-country sourcing risks.

In response to tariff-driven cost volatility, manufacturers and integrators have employed a mix of tactical and structural responses. Tactically, firms have expanded duty engineering and classification efforts to identify optimal tariff codes and pursue available exclusions where applicable. Structurally, several organizations have accelerated initiatives to relocate critical manufacturing steps closer to major demand centers, adopt dual-sourcing for strategic inputs, and invest in supplier development to raise local content. These practical shifts reduce vulnerability to abrupt policy changes and shorten logistical lead times, although they often require upfront capital and operational transition costs.

Because tariffs can alter competitive dynamics, companies have re-evaluated pricing strategies and margin expectations while seeking to preserve feature differentiation through design innovations. The net effect has been a greater emphasis on supply chain resilience as an element of product competitiveness, with firms coordinating more closely across procurement, engineering, and finance to manage the combined impacts of trade measures, transportation constraints, and component availability.

Deep segmentation insights exposing how application demands, product architectures, frequency bands, end-user requirements, and sales channels jointly determine competitive advantage

Segmentation analysis reveals distinct value drivers and operational considerations across applications, product typologies, frequency bands, end-user industries, and sales channels. When viewed through the lens of application, requirements diverge sharply between industrial non-destructive testing, which prioritizes robustness and repeatable measurement under harsh conditions, medical imaging, which demands stringent regulatory compliance and ultra-low noise performance, and underwater sonar, which emphasizes range and ruggedized form factors. Each application imposes different tolerances on design choices, materials, and verification regimes, and firms that align engineering roadmaps to these differentiated needs capture greater adoption within their target verticals.

Considering product type, array architectures, phased arrays, and single-element transducers each bring unique trade-offs in terms of beamforming capability, spatial resolution, and manufacturing complexity. Array products enable sophisticated beam steering and imaging techniques but require more complex electronics and calibration processes, while single-element designs can offer cost advantages for simpler sensing tasks. Frequency range segmentation into high frequency above 10 MHz, mid frequency between 1 and 10 MHz, and low frequency below 1 MHz maps directly to application performance: higher frequencies deliver finer resolution for near-field imaging, mid frequencies serve general-purpose sensing, and low frequencies provide longer propagation distances for underwater or large-structure inspection.

End-user considerations across aerospace, automotive, electronics, healthcare, and industrial markets further shape product specifications, procurement cycles, and service expectations. Aerospace and automotive sectors emphasize qualification regimes and lifecycle traceability, electronics manufacturers focus on high-volume reproducibility, healthcare demands documented clinical validation, and industrial users prioritize durability and ease of field maintenance. Finally, sales channel segmentation into direct sales, distributors, and e-commerce platforms affects lead times, customization options, and after-sales support models. Organizations that tailor channel strategies to buyer preferences-combining direct engagement for complex system sales with distributor or e-commerce routes for commoditized modules-improve customer satisfaction and operational efficiency.

How distinct regional demand drivers, manufacturing ecosystems, and regulatory expectations across the Americas, Europe Middle East & Africa, and Asia-Pacific influence strategic market positioning

Regional dynamics shape both demand patterns and supply-side strategies for ultrasonic transducer cab technologies, with distinct drivers and constraints in the Americas, Europe, Middle East & Africa, and Asia-Pacific. In the Americas, demand reflects strong activity in aerospace and medical imaging, supported by a robust innovation ecosystem and access to advanced materials and electronics suppliers. This environment fosters collaboration between universities, research labs, and industry, accelerating prototyping cycles and commercial deployments. Additionally, policy emphasis on domestic manufacturing and strategic technology programs has encouraged capacity investments and supplier qualification efforts.

The Europe, Middle East & Africa region combines advanced manufacturing capabilities with exacting regulatory standards, particularly in medical and defense domains. European buyers often require extensive compliance documentation and predictable long-term support, leading suppliers to maintain localized qualification and service operations. In several Middle Eastern markets, government-led infrastructure and maritime projects drive demand for underwater sensing capabilities, prompting targeted procurement cycles. Across the region, sustainability and environmental compliance considerations increasingly influence material sourcing and product lifecycle planning.

Asia-Pacific remains a critical hub for component manufacturing and volume production. The region benefits from integrated supply chains, competitive electronics manufacturing, and a growing base of system integrators. Rapid adoption in industrial automation, consumer electronics testing, and maritime surveillance supports scale, while variations in regulatory regimes and intellectual property enforcement require careful commercial and legal strategies. Together, these regional traits inform where firms choose to locate production, center R&D, and prioritize market entry activities to optimize responsiveness and total operating cost.

Competitive and ecosystem dynamics explaining how IP leadership, manufacturing scale, and collaborative partnerships determine supplier selection and long-term market strength

Competitive dynamics in the ultrasonic transducer cab space reflect a diverse set of players including specialized component manufacturers, vertically integrated system suppliers, contract manufacturers focusing on precision assembly, and innovative startups developing next-generation transducer technologies. Market incumbents frequently defend their positions through combinations of technical differentiation, manufacturing scale, and established certification credentials, while smaller firms compete by offering niche innovations or faster customization cycles. This interplay shapes collaboration patterns: partnerships, licensing arrangements, and targeted acquisitions commonly serve as mechanisms to access complementary capabilities or accelerate time-to-market.

Intellectual property plays a central role, particularly around proprietary material formulations, transducer geometries, and signal processing algorithms that improve sensitivity and imaging fidelity. Companies that pair strong IP portfolios with disciplined quality systems and robust supply relationships gain preferred-supplier status for high-stakes applications. At the same time, the emergence of micromachined transducer platforms and hybrid architectures has lowered certain barriers to entry, increasing the strategic importance of ecosystem relationships such as foundry partnerships and electronics suppliers.

Buyers evaluate suppliers not only on unit performance but on lifecycle support, traceability, and the ability to co-develop solutions. As a result, companies that invest in comprehensive validation capabilities, responsive after-sales service, and modular platforms that support incremental upgrades strengthen long-term customer retention. Observing these dynamics helps buyers and investors identify where to allocate resources, whether to prioritize proprietary development, strategic alliances, or supply chain resilience measures.

Actionable strategic measures for market leaders to synchronize product development, supply resilience, compliance, and commercial channels to secure sustainable advantage

Industry leaders should adopt coordinated actions that align product development, sourcing, and commercial execution to capture opportunities while mitigating risk. First, integrate design and procurement teams early in product development cycles so material selection and manufacturability constraints inform design decisions; this reduces time lost to rework and improves yield during scale-up. Second, implement a multi-source strategy for strategic inputs that balances cost efficiency with continuity, and couple this with supplier development programs to elevate local capability where nearshoring or regionalization is prioritized.

Third, invest in modular, software-defined architectures that allow hardware to remain stable while enabling functionality upgrades through software and signal-processing advances. This approach extends product lifecycles and preserves margin in the face of cyclical component cost fluctuations. Fourth, strengthen certification and validation pipelines for regulated applications by building internal testing capabilities and maintaining close dialogue with regulatory bodies to anticipate compliance changes. Fifth, pursue focused partnerships and selective acquisitions to access complementary technologies such as advanced piezoelectric materials, micromachining capabilities, or signal-processing IP, rather than attempting to internalize all capabilities at once.

Finally, align commercial channels with customer needs by combining direct sales for complex, high-touch systems with distributor and digital sales strategies for commoditized modules. Complement these channels with robust after-sales support and data-driven maintenance offerings. Executing these strategic priorities will improve resilience, accelerate innovation, and enhance the ability to convert technological advances into measurable commercial outcomes.
